Xlib doesn't provide current window titles

Bug #802844 reported by Ray
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Ubuntu
Expired
Undecided
Unassigned

Bug Description

I'm using the Python Xlib bindings to go through all of the xlib windows, and access their wm names using win.get_wm_name(). This bit of code used to work in earlier versions of Ubuntu, but ever since switching to Unity, many windows are marked as not 'viewable' and their window titles seem to be the titles provided during initialization, not the updated ones. A good example of this is that gedit will say its title is 'gedit', and not 'Untitled Document 1 - gedit', like it used to. This behavior is visible in other code as well, like suckless.org's lsw utility, which is programmed in C. I'm saying "I don't know" for the package name, since this may be a side-effect of unity...

Revision history for this message
Thijs van Dijk (ametheus-deactivatedaccount) wrote :

This might be related to bug 666501 or bug 810423. The common factor there seems to be compiz.
Are you currently using compiz? If so, (and this is a wild guess) does the problem persist if you switch to a different window manager?

Changed in ubuntu:
status: New → Incomplete
Revision history for this message
Launchpad Janitor (janitor) wrote :

[Expired for Ubuntu because there has been no activity for 60 days.]

Changed in ubuntu:
status: Incomplete → Expired
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.